mucus plug

Has anyone lost this yet? I am 27 weeks and I am pretty sire I lost mine today I called my doc because of blood when I wiped (this was after loosing the mucus earlier in the morning) he has me on watch for anymore blood, contractions, and counting kicks of LO I am out of state so if I end up having to go in it will be to a completely different hospital. I hope all goes well. I am very nervous. Thoughts and prayers are appreciated.

    As PPs have said, lots of women lose their mucus plug over and over...I was told that it's fairly common and does not necessarily indicate labor. They can regenerate multiple times. It's does not mean "it won't be long now" at all.

    Sorry you're dealing with this, OP. It's true that the mucus plug can come off in parts and regenerate, however the "bloody show" mucus is of a different sort, and more worrisome in terms of potential early dilation/effacement of your cervix.

    I did go into labor a couple of days after seeing "bloody show" with my first. Of course it could be different for you. A friend of mine saw some bloody discharge at 29 weeks and went immediately for an ultrasound of her cervix, which showed it was still long and closed. She's 35 weeks now and still pregnant.

    Take care, be well, and try not to worry until you have more information. xx
